Abstract: A portable, lightweight clothes drying rack, adapted to be erected over a shower stall or bathtub enclosure to extend between a shower curtain rod and an opposing vertical enclosure wall; the device comprising a rigid, unitary member having a linear portion which is operationally supported near one end by the shower curtain rod and is formed with an upturned portion at its opposite end which is engageable with the enclosure wall at an elevation above the shower curtain rod. A stop means, adjustably movable along the member to accommodate variations in the shower curtain rod to wall distance, also serves to couple the linear portion to the curtain rod and stabilize the device in operating position.
Abstract: A positive cam lock for a pair of telescoping extension poles. The cam support is mounted to the inner pole and carries a coaxially rotatably mounted idler cam and an eccentrically rotatably mounted locking cam. The outer pole has a number of inwardly extending splines which engage corresponding grooves on the locking and idler cams. When the outer pole is rotated, the eccentric cam will rotate and lock the outer pole at a desired axial position with respect to the inner pole while the idler cam prevents misalignment. A key mounted to the locking cam rides in a keyway on the cam support for preventing over-rotation of the locking cam.

Abstract: A conveyor trough construction, particularly for scraper chain conveyors, comprises a conveyor having longitudinal side walls formed with a plurality of abutting sections, each having a longitudinally extending bore therethrough which aligns with the next adjacent section. The bores of adjacent pairs of sections terminate in inwardly bevelled ends, and a coupling bolt extends through the bores of adjacent sections and terminates at each of its ends with an inwardly tapered portion which is engaged in the inwardly tapered ends of the bores. Each section is provided with a side wall opening, which extends into the bore, and a locking spring is inserted in the opening and engaged over the coupling bolt. The bore of the sections is dimensioned to provide an axial clearance for the locking spring.
